1. 程式人生 > >C語言(1)

C語言(1)

c語言 一丶知識點小結 1丶常量與變數 (1)常量與變數是C語言中處理資料的兩種形式。 (2)常量在程式執行中不可改變,而變數是可以改變的。 (3)賦值時用int,float,double,char等。 (4)使用變數時必須宣告,宣告變數必須在第一條可執行語句前。 2二進位制與其他進位制 (1)計算機中的資料等都是用二進位制儲存的。 (2)注意二進位制與其他進位制的轉換。 3丶賦值運算 (1)“a=b"即“把b賦值給a”,而不是“a與b相等”。 (2)賦值運算左邊只能是變數,而不能是常量或表示式。 4丶輸入與輸出 (1)輸入:“cin”,“scanf( )”。 輸出:“cout,“printf( )”。 (2)cin,cout比scanf,printf運算慢。 5丶運算子 (1)”+”,"-","*","/","%"。 (2)"&&","||","!"(非)。 (3)"==","<=","<=","!="。 (3)自增運算子。a++的意思為在使用a後,使a加1;++a的意思為在使用a前,使a加1。 自減同上。 6丶常用標頭檔案 (1)iostream–輸入輸出。 (2)cmath-一些數學運算,如向上去整(ceil)等。 (3)iomanip–保留小數(fixed setprecision)等。 7丶if語句 (1)格式 if(條件表示式) { 迴圈語句 } (2)雙分支語句 if(表示式) 語句 else 語句 (3)多分支語句 if(表示式) 語句 else if(表示式) 語句 . . . else if(表示式) 語句 else 語句 (4)注意: 條件後面不能加";"。 強調條件用單分支。 8丶switch語句(開關語句) (1)格式 switch(表示式) { case 表示式; 語句; break; case 表示式; 語句; break; … case 表示式; 語句; break; default: 語句; } (2)注意 switch語句後面的表示式是離散數值表示式(整數,字元型,列舉)。 當case後的工作一樣時,不用寫break。 break表示在執行完一個case語句後,停止執行整個語句。 二丶學習了c語言,生活中的很多問題都可以用c語言來解決,利用c語言可以把簡單的數學運算交給程式來完成,使得複雜的事情簡單化,解決一些簡單的數學問題,但我相信,c語言以後會大展拳腳。 三丶c語言是非常嚴謹,規範的東西,只要在程式設計中出一點錯誤或者打錯一個字母,都會是程式設計錯誤,即使程式設計沒有錯誤,也不會A。另外程式設計是還必須考慮周全,不放過任何一種情況,否則,即使是樣例通過,也會因為考慮不周不會是A,c語言還要求規範,追求程式設計的美;c語言的邏輯很強學習c語言有助於培養我們的邏輯思維能力和思維方式。我是一個不怎麼細心的人,但我喜歡c語言。學習c語言可以使我更加得細心,全面。 我是一名小白,只是略微地瞭解程式設計,但我喜歡c語言,願意每天用一段時間去學習c語言,敲程式碼。現在的我們只學習了滄海一粟,看不清前進的路,只能逐步摸索,在黑夜中前行,每次出現Accepted時,都會感到十分高興。但還不夠,只有努力學習,才能到達新的高度,我希望c語言程式設計會成為我的職業,我會努力去做到